Web20 apr. 2024 · In 2016, there were 820,120 Status First Nations people in Canada. Of those, 40% (331,025) lived on reserve. The Status First Nations population is younger than the non-Indigenous population. Almost 1 in 3 Status First Nations people living on reserve were younger than 15. Thunder Bay is the Census Metropolitan Area with the highest proportion of Indigenous people in Canada (12.7 per cent of the population).
